Having lived under the careful and sheltered upbringing of his older brother Sena, Juniper, a naive and curious Kitsune (fox spirit), embarks on a journey through the Interstellar world. Transported from his familiar realm, Juniper stumbles upon long-lost abilities that have been absent in this futuristic domain for ages, integrates into this new world, discovers the wonders of his unique powers while navigating the challenges of his daily life, all the while forming connections with newfound friends and romantic interests. *Shares same universe to my other novel ''The Unconventional days of a Fox Demon''* ~This is very much a slice of life with little to no drama, just fluff and daily life~
